Output 0666c8fb880abe2b46600b915db6435ebc34edf65a59b84f2e2bc90a93a5b658:2

value
20664181
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b4f3ab11f85ac802ea93749542d23922c1a16cff OP_EQUALVERIFY OP_CHECKSIG
address
1HVnXtxVLDSPjS55tB7uK6duo15eJCrhkz
transaction
0666c8fb880abe2b46600b915db6435ebc34edf65a59b84f2e2bc90a93a5b658
spent
true